Does anyone have any experience with Tune-Up or any similar programs for organizing your library. The main thing I need is I have several HD with ripped CDs and I know I have lots of duplicates and rather than go through 2+TBs of files by hand it would be nice to let a program do it.

I have had it for a year. My current library is 70 000 songs on a 3TB drive. The current version for Mac does not work right and are some bugs. The past one is good. I had lots of music missing info and at first would go letter to letter at a set time. Took me a long time. I could have just hit auto correct everything one and it did have some errors on cover art. Overall I am glad I paid for it and was happy with what it gave me. You do need to invest some sit time in making sure you pick the right art and info. Try the trial version and see what you think.
